周立功逻辑分析仪的使用?
1、硬件通道连接,首先我们要把逻辑分析仪的GND和待测板子的GND连到一起,以保证信号的完整性。然后把逻辑分析仪的通道接到待测引脚上,待测引脚可以用多种方式引出来。
2、通道数设置,一般情况下,大多数逻辑分析仪有8通道、16通道、32通道等数目。而我们采集信号的时候,往往用不到那么多通道,为了我们更清晰的观察波形,可以把用不到的通道隐藏起来。
3、采样率和采样深度设置,首先要对待测信号最高频率有个大概的评估,把采样率设置到它的10倍以上,还要大概判断一下我们要采集的信号的时间长短,在设置采样深度的时候,尽量设置的有一定的余量。采样深度除以采样率,得到的就是我们可以保存信号的时间。
4、触发设置,由于逻辑分析仪有深度限制,不可能无限期的保存数据。当我们使用逻辑分析仪的时候,如果没有采用任何触发设置的话,从开始抓取就开始计算时间,一直到存满我们设置的存储深度后,抓取就停止。在实际操作过程中,开始抓取的一段信号可能是无用信号,有用信号可能就是其中一段,但是无用信号还占据了我们的存储空间。在这种情况下,我们就可以通过设置触发来提高存储深度的利用率。比如我们如果想抓取UART串口信号,而串口信号平时没有数据的时候是高电平,因此我们可以设置一个下降沿触发。从点击开始抓取,逻辑分析仪不会把抓到的信号保存到我们的存储器中,而是会等待一个下降沿的产生,一旦产生了下降沿,才开始进行真正的信号采集,并且把采集到的信号存储到存储器中。也就是说,从点击开始抓取到下降沿这段时间内的无用信号,被我们所设置的触发给屏蔽掉了,这是一个非常实用的功能。
5、抓取波形,逻辑分析仪和示波器不同,示波器是实时显示的,而逻辑分析仪需要点击开始,开始抓取波形,一直到存储满了我们所设置的存储深度结束,然后我们可以慢慢的去分析我们抓到的信号,因此点击“开始抓取”这个是必须要有的。
6、设置协议解析(标准协议),如果你抓取的波形是标准协议,比如UART、I2C、SPI这种协议,逻辑分析仪一般都会配有专门的解码器,可以通过设置解码器,不仅仅像示波器那样把波形显示出来,还可以直接把数据解析出来,以十六进制、二进制、ASCII码等各种形式显示出来。
7、数据分析,和示波器类似逻辑分析仪也有各种测量标线,可以测量脉冲宽度,测量波形的频率,占空比等信息,通过数据分析,查找我们的波形是否符合我们的要求,从而帮助我们解决问题。
我想买一个逻辑分析仪,请问哪个牌子的好?
如果手上有 STM32 的开发板,可以用
Analyzer2Go
把 STM32 开发板变成逻辑分析仪。
另外,可以考虑一下
DSLogic
,开源的,基于
sigrok
如何使用keil中的逻辑分析仪(logic analyzer)?
1、首先要进入调试界面。
2、点击箭头所指向的按钮,选择logic analyzer,会出现一个对话框,有的时候对话框是固定的,你需要将其拖曳出来。
3、图片上是几个功能键的介绍,也可以通过鼠标滚轮的滑动改编每格的大小。
4、在左上角单击setup,会出现一个对话框。需要在里面配置端口的引脚。
5、我程序里配置的是PA0推挽输出,所以在框里要写“PORTA.0”然后敲回车,再左键单击这一行。
6、下面要配置下面的选项,选择Bit。
7、然后关掉对话框。单击运行程序,即可。如果你想观察实时的波形状态,一定要切记要在调试的状态下选择view菜单下的 periodic window update。
哪家的逻辑分析仪好用一些?
现在市面上的逻辑分析仪可谓满目琳琅但却良莠不齐,想要选一款合适的逻辑分析仪可要慎重,首先要定位好几大品牌,泰克和安捷伦已经是老品牌了,ZLG致远电子目前在仪器方面突飞猛进,可在考虑范围之内。
其次,要分析逻辑分析仪的几大重要因素,存储深度,通道数,采样率,协议分析能力等等。
2、逻辑分析仪的功能是什么?它在FPGA设计中的作用是什么?
逻辑分析仪是用来分析复杂的逻辑时序的。如果使用fpga的话,会经常用到。例如,你在fpga中编写了一个较为复杂的逻辑程序,你可以使用fpga自带的逻辑分析仪(XILINX: CHIPSCOPE, ALTERA: SIGNAL TAP )来捕捉fpga的输入输出信号,观察逻辑时序对不对,从而更改自己的程序代码。
网络分析仪和逻辑分析仪的区别?
网络分析仪:可用于表征射频器件。尽管最初只是测量 S 参数,但为了优于被测器件,现在的网络分析仪已经高度集成,并且非常先进。射频电路需要独特的测试方法。在高频内很难直接测量电压和电流,因此在测量高频器件时,必须通过它们对射频信号的响应情况来对其进行表征。网络分析仪可将已知信号发送到器件、然后对输入信号和输出信号进行定比测量,以此来实现对器件的表征。
逻辑分析仪源出于示波器。它们用和示波器相同的方式展现数据,水平轴代表时间,垂直轴代表电压幅度。但与示波器提供很高的电压分辨率及时间间隔精度不同,逻辑分析仪能同时捕获和显示数百个信号,这是示波器达不到的。当系统中的信号穿越阈值电平时,逻辑分析仪的反应与您的逻辑电路相同。它能识别信号是低电平还是高电平。
逻辑分析仪为什么会干扰i2c信号?
原因如下:
1、在设计逻辑电路的印刷电路板的同时,其地线应该构成闭环的形式,这样可以有效的提高电路抗干扰能力。
2、地线应尽量的粗。我们都知道,细的线电阻较大,电阻大的话会造成接地电位随着电流的变化而变化,这样的话会导致信号电平不稳,继而造成电路的抗干扰能力下降。
ZLG致远电子的逻辑分析仪如何使用?
其实使用ZLG致远电子的逻辑分析仪进行信号采集和解码前主要的设置有以下几步:
首先设置总线配置,使用什么型号的总线就设置成什么,且自己命名总线的名称。
其次设置采样模式,采样率,存储深度,门限电压,勾选压缩存储。
设置触发,触发的信息设置如触发模式、波特率等等 设置解码信息 设置完以上的信息即可进行信号采集与解码,这里要强调的是逻辑分析仪只有采集到完整的数据帧才能够解码成功。
逻辑分析仪有没有什么注意事项?
使用个逻辑分析仪的时有几点要注意:
1、如果记录时间不需要很长,可以设置较小的存储深度。因为存储空间使用过大,采集的数据量会很多,分析起来所消耗的时间会较长。
2、合理设置触发条件,因为触发模块对信号流实时监控,所以能保证无死区捕获到用户关心的数据,采样回来也能马上定位到该位置。如果不合理设置触发条件,则只能通过大批量采样数据,然后使用查找功能定位,这样用户关心的信号不一定能采样到,而且分析效率也低。
3、涉及到协议分析仪的,要保证至少采集一个完整的数据帧,保证所需分析数据的完整性。
4、LA2000A系列逻辑分析建议任何条件下都使用最高采样率及压缩存储,这样能保证长时间采样高保真信号,有利有重建真实波形,做完整分析。